Description:
Diana Green, n.d.. Trade Paperback. Mimeographed sheets, recto only, i, Act 1, 8 scenes, 63 pages; Act 2, 5 scenes, 42 pages. The play was adapted from Nathaniel West's novel 'Miss Lonely Hearts'. 'Property of Diana Green' printed on title page. Ink stamp 'Diana Green, 174 West 76 Street, New York, N.Y., TRafalger 4-3305' on title page. Howard Teichmann (1916-1987) was a playwright, producer, director and writer. With George S. Kaufman he wrote the 1953 comedy hit 'The Solid Gold Cadillac,' his first Broadway play. Previously he had worked with Orson Welles at Mercury Theatre. He was a winner of Emmy and Peabody awards. First edition (first printing). Very good copy in black folder bound with 2 folding metal fasteners. Damage to upper right of title page, not affecting title. Wear to covers.

Description:
Tales From Town Topics, 1895. First Edition. Hardcover. 255 pages. 'Tales from Town Topics' was a New York-based magazine of fiction, humor and light verse which began in 1891 as Town Topics. Most issues featured a longer fiction piece followed by shorter pieces. Around 1905, it was either absorbed or renamed as 'Tales,' which was renamed 'Transatlantic Tales' before ending in 1908. First edition (first printing). A very good copy in marbled paper over board and quarter brown leather covers with gilt lettering on spine. 'A Very Remarkable Girl' is title of lead 'novelette' in this issue. That title is printed on spine above'Tales From Town Topics.' Front hinge is broken but binding is tight. Edge and corner wear to covers. Uncommon. Additional titles in this series are available,

Description:
1785. Ephemera. 1. ALS: Single sheet folded with letter written on outside page only. Bottom of the page has been cut away. Fold is split and separating. On rear in same hand 'Dec. 6, 1785 / Bp of Gloucester at Bishop(?) and the g.' Letter content: 'Warsop, near Mansfield, 6 Decr. 1785 / Sir, / I intend being in London about (the) middle of next month, and shall bring up with me what I have prepared on (the) Character & Writings of Bp. Butler, in order to be prefaced to (the) new Edition of his Analogy. I wd send up part of (the) copy to you now; but before it goes to (the) Press, I shd like to re-consider (the) Change (of which I have no Copy) & also to consult a few books, which I cannot get at this place. If (the) Change be printed off, I wish you wd in close (the) sheets to me here. And pray let me know, in what forwardness (the) new edition is, & how much, or whether any be yet printed. In (the) title page shd be added after the Latin quotation 'Ejas (Analogiae) haec vis est' etc., as follows. /…
